Description

The Jackson is a perfect ranch style home. The main floor consists of all the essentials showcasing the owner's suite, laundry room, and study room. The owner's suite contains a pleasing four-piece bathroom. The architects held nothing back when designing the kitchen; it is made up of a welcoming boomerang style island and a great amount of space. The basement has everything a family would want, including an in-home theater! On top of that there is a spacious recreational room. In the basement you will also find two bedrooms; one with a walk-in closet and a bathroom consisting of two sinks for the two separate bedrooms.

The Jackson Plan is a buildable plan in Jackson Creek North. Jackson Creek North is a new community in Monument, CO. This buildable plan is a 5 bedroom, 4 bathroom, 3,241 sqft single-family home and was listed by Desert View Homes on Feb 10, 2026. The asking price for The Jackson Plan is $639,995.
